Get a Remote File's Owner

Demonstrates the Chilkat SFtp.GetFileOwner method, which returns a remote file's owner. The arguments are the remote path (or handle), whether symbolic links are followed, and whether the first argument is a handle.
Background: Ownership determines who may read, write, or change a file under Unix permission rules, so reading the owner is useful for auditing or for deciding whether an operation will be allowed. Note that a server may report the owner as a numeric UID rather than a name if it cannot resolve the account, and that ownership is a Unix concept — servers on other platforms may return an empty or synthetic value.

#include <CkSFtp.h>
void ChilkatSample(void)
{
bool success = false;
// Demonstrates the SFtp.GetFileOwner method, which returns a remote file's owner. The 1st
// argument is the remote path (or handle), the 2nd selects whether symbolic links are followed,
// and the 3rd indicates whether the 1st argument is a handle.
CkSFtp sftp;
// Connect, authenticate, and initialize the SFTP subsystem.
int port = 22;
success = sftp.Connect("sftp.example.com",port);
if (success == false) {
std::cout << sftp.lastErrorText() << "\r\n";
return;
}
// Normally you would not hard-code the password in source. You should instead obtain it
// from an interactive prompt, environment variable, or a secrets vault.
const char *password = "mySshPassword";
success = sftp.AuthenticatePw("mySshLogin",password);
if (success == false) {
std::cout << sftp.lastErrorText() << "\r\n";
return;
}
success = sftp.InitializeSftp();
if (success == false) {
std::cout << sftp.lastErrorText() << "\r\n";
return;
}
// The 2nd argument (bFollowLinks) selects whether a symbolic link is followed to its target.
// The 3rd argument (bIsHandle) is false here because the 1st argument is a path, not an
// open handle.
bool bFollowLinks = true;
bool bIsHandle = false;
const char *owner = sftp.getFileOwner("subdir/report.pdf",bFollowLinks,bIsHandle);
if (sftp.get_LastMethodSuccess() == false) {
std::cout << sftp.lastErrorText() << "\r\n";
return;
}
std::cout << "Owner: " << owner << "\r\n";
sftp.Disconnect();
}
